// Standard JPEG quantisation tables, in zigzag order.
static const unsigned char vaapi_encode_mjpeg_quant_luminance[64] = {
    16,  11,  12,  14,  12,  10,  16,  14,
    13,  14,  18,  17,  16,  19,  24,  40,
    26,  24,  22,  22,  24,  49,  35,  37,
    29,  40,  58,  51,  61,  60,  57,  51,
    56,  55,  64,  72,  92,  78,  64,  68,
    87,  69,  55,  56,  80, 109,  81,  87,
    95,  98, 103, 104, 103,  62,  77, 113,
   121, 112, 100, 120,  92, 101, 103,  99,
};
static const unsigned char vaapi_encode_mjpeg_quant_chrominance[64] = {
    17,  18,  18,  24,  21,  24,  47,  26,
    26,  47,  99,  66,  56,  66,  99,  99,
    99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,
    99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,
    99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,
    99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,
    99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,
    99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,  99,
};

static int vaapi_encode_mjpeg_write_image_header(AVCodecContext *avctx,
                                                 VAAPIEncodePicture *pic,
                                                 VAAPIEncodeSlice *slice,
                                                 char *data, size_t *data_len)
{
    VAAPIEncodeContext               *ctx = avctx->priv_data;
    VAEncPictureParameterBufferJPEG *vpic = pic->codec_picture_params;
    VAEncSliceParameterBufferJPEG *vslice = slice->codec_slice_params;
    VAAPIEncodeMJPEGContext         *priv = ctx->priv_data;
    PutBitContext pbc;
    int t, i, quant_scale;

    init_put_bits(&pbc, data, *data_len);

    vaapi_encode_mjpeg_write_marker(&pbc, SOI);

    // Quantisation table coefficients are scaled for quality by the driver,
    // so we also need to do it ourselves here so that headers match.
    if (priv->quality < 50)
        quant_scale = 5000 / priv->quality;
    else
        quant_scale = 200 - 2 * priv->quality;

    for (t = 0; t < 2; t++) {
        int q;

        vaapi_encode_mjpeg_write_marker(&pbc, DQT);

        put_bits(&pbc, 16, 3 + 64); // Lq
        put_bits(&pbc, 4, 0); // Pq
        put_bits(&pbc, 4, t); // Tq

        for (i = 0; i < 64; i++) {
            q = i[t ? priv->quant_tables.chroma_quantiser_matrix
                    : priv->quant_tables.lum_quantiser_matrix];
            q = (q * quant_scale) / 100;
            if (q < 1)   q = 1;
            if (q > 255) q = 255;
            put_bits(&pbc, 8, q);
        }
    }

    vaapi_encode_mjpeg_write_marker(&pbc, SOF0);

    put_bits(&pbc, 16, 8 + 3 * vpic->num_components); // Lf
    put_bits(&pbc, 8,  vpic->sample_bit_depth); // P
    put_bits(&pbc, 16, vpic->picture_height);   // Y
    put_bits(&pbc, 16, vpic->picture_width);    // X
    put_bits(&pbc, 8,  vpic->num_components);   // Nf

    for (i = 0; i < vpic->num_components; i++) {
        put_bits(&pbc, 8, vpic->component_id[i]); // Ci
        put_bits(&pbc, 4, priv->component_subsample_h[i]); // Hi
        put_bits(&pbc, 4, priv->component_subsample_v[i]); // Vi
        put_bits(&pbc, 8, vpic->quantiser_table_selector[i]); // Tqi
    }

    for (t = 0; t < 4; t++) {
        int mt;
        unsigned char *lengths, *values;

        vaapi_encode_mjpeg_write_marker(&pbc, DHT);

        if ((t & 1) == 0) {
            lengths = priv->huffman_tables.huffman_table[t / 2].num_dc_codes;
            values  = priv->huffman_tables.huffman_table[t / 2].dc_values;
        } else {
            lengths = priv->huffman_tables.huffman_table[t / 2].num_ac_codes;
            values  = priv->huffman_tables.huffman_table[t / 2].ac_values;
        }

        mt = 0;
        for (i = 0; i < 16; i++)
            mt += lengths[i];

        put_bits(&pbc, 16, 2 + 17 + mt); // Lh
        put_bits(&pbc, 4, t & 1); // Tc
        put_bits(&pbc, 4, t / 2); // Th

        for (i = 0; i < 16; i++)
            put_bits(&pbc, 8, lengths[i]);
        for (i = 0; i < mt; i++)
            put_bits(&pbc, 8, values[i]);
    }

    vaapi_encode_mjpeg_write_marker(&pbc, SOS);

    av_assert0(vpic->num_components == vslice->num_components);

    put_bits(&pbc, 16, 6 + 2 * vslice->num_components); // Ls
    put_bits(&pbc, 8,  vslice->num_components); // Ns

    for (i = 0; i < vslice->num_components; i++) {
        put_bits(&pbc, 8, vslice->components[i].component_selector); // Csj
        put_bits(&pbc, 4, vslice->components[i].dc_table_selector);  // Tdj
        put_bits(&pbc, 4, vslice->components[i].ac_table_selector);  // Taj
    }

    put_bits(&pbc, 8, 0); // Ss
    put_bits(&pbc, 8, 63); // Se
    put_bits(&pbc, 4, 0); // Ah
    put_bits(&pbc, 4, 0); // Al

    *data_len = put_bits_count(&pbc);
    flush_put_bits(&pbc);

    return 0;
}
